How Strength Training Equipment Works Mechanically
Mechanics in strength training involves lines of force, torque demands, and the angles at which muscles are activated. Two primary forces at play are:
- Resistance: This can be bodyweight or external weights, applied primarily through gravity.
- Muscle Tension: When muscles contract to overcome resistance, tension is created, which stimulates muscular adaptation and growth.
The angle at which you lift weights significantly impacts the muscles engaged. For instance, a bench press primarily activates the pectorals, while a squat engages the glutes and quads, thereby varying the effectiveness of the equipment based on user positioning and biomechanics.
Types of Strength Training Equipment
1. Barbells

A barbell, a straight metal bar on which weight plates are added, is fundamental in strength training.
- Mechanical Function: The center of gravity is critical. The barbell’s length influences stability; a longer bar increases torque demands on the lifter’s body.
- Muscles Trained: From squats to deadlifts, barbells enable full-body training, focusing on compound movements that engage multiple muscle groups simultaneously.

3. Power Cages and Squat Racks

These devices provide a safe and structured environment for intense lifting, designed to catch the barbell if the lifter fails.
- Mechanical Function: With adjustable height settings, they can accommodate various exercises and lifters’ heights.
- Common Exercises: Back squats, bench presses, and overhead presses.
4. Machines (Smith, Leg Press, Lat Pulldown)

Strength training machines guide your movements and help to isolate specific muscles.
- Mechanical Function: Machines like the Smith machine allow for a fixed path of motion while providing some safety, making them ideal for beginners.
- Muscles Trained: Machines often target specific muscle groups, minimizing the involvement of stabilizing muscles.
